## Building Access: Bike Cage & Parking Gates — Calden Point

Bike cage is behind Block C, accessible 06:00–22:00. Contractors may use racks 12–20 only; do not lock to the gate frame. Vehicle parking: use the east gates off Withy Lane, bays marked V. Gates open automatically on exit. Overnight parking requires prior approval from Facilities. Both the cage door and the parking gate keypad accept the same entry code, shown below.

door code, yagap-bahof: bdg-O-05

Feedwarden, the podcast feed validator behind Castlerow Audio's ingest pipeline, is rejecting more than 5% of submitted feeds in the last hour. Common causes are malformed episode GUIDs, oversized artwork, or publishers pushing drafts with missing enclosure tags. Support: before escalating, check whether failures cluster on a single publisher — if so, it's likely their feed, not our validator. Reply to affected publishers with the standard remediation template. The triage flowchart and template are on the page below.

dashboard of bafof-hafog = https://confluence.lumiclabs.internal/display/browse/display/6a09a20a

**Release checklist — cron migration**

- Confirm all nightly jobs moved from crontab on `sched-prod-2` into Loomwheel workflows.
- Verify retry policies set (3 attempts, exponential backoff).
- Delete legacy cron entries only after two clean runs.
- Owner: Priya's platform squad.
- Rollback: re-enable crontab, disable Loomwheel triggers.

For the sync, note that the cutover is pinned to the following build.

session token of tajef-bageg = htk21_5d90d574934f3ccae6437

Hi! Handing over Gallerio, the audio-guide app for the Marrowfield Museum. Most pages are about sync failures between the exhibit beacons and the tour playlist — usually a stale cache, just bounce the beacon-sync worker. Downloads failing on the kiosk tablets is rarer but uglier; there's a runbook in the ops folder. If you get stuck after hours, escalate straight to the person on record.

named custodian: Rusion Joreth Holvan Norwyn